Title of article :
SIMS analysis and optical study of annealed iron-doped LiNbO3 crystal

Abstract :
The distribution of iron content along the depth of annealed LiNbO3 substrates has been measured by the secondary ion mass spectrometry (SIMS). It is found that Fe out-diffuses to the surface of annealed LiNbO3 crystals, causing a high content of Fe in a thin surface layer. Planar waveguides have been fabricated from both unannealed and annealed crystals by the proton exchanged method, and two-wave mixing experiments have revealed an enhanced photorefractive effect in the waveguide of the annealed LiNbO3 crystal.
